What makes this coffee one of a kind?
This limited microlot is the result of a 30 hour dry anaerobic co-ferment; where oxygen is removed to intensify flavour, and fresh peaches are introduced to infuse the coffee with their natural sugars and aromatics. This process is designed to push flavour boundaries and sweetness.
Gently washed and dried at low temperatures, the result is, a big peachy punch. Delivering tasting notes of golden peach candy, tropical sweetness, and a soft coconut finish.
Grown by Luz Helena Salazar at Maracay Farm in Colombia, this lot represents over 20 years of dedication to craft and innovation. Luz has become a leading force in experimental processing, working closely with Cofinet to produce standout coffees while uplifting her local community.
